Your Essential Guide to Women’s Backpacks for Travel Carry-On
Choosing the right carry-on backpack for your travels makes a big difference. It needs to be comfortable, hold everything you need, and fit easily in the overhead bin. This guide will help you find the perfect travel companion.
Key Features to Look For
When shopping, keep these important features in mind:
- Capacity: Look for a backpack that holds between 30-45 liters. This size is usually allowed as a carry-on and is big enough for a few days’ worth of clothes and essentials.
- Comfort: Padded shoulder straps and a padded back panel are crucial. They help distribute weight evenly, making it more comfortable to wear, especially on longer walks. A chest strap or hip belt can add even more stability and comfort.
- Organization: Multiple compartments and pockets help you stay organized. Separate sections for your laptop, water bottle, and smaller items make finding things easy. A front-loading design, like a suitcase, is often more convenient than a top-loading one.
- Durability: Strong zippers, reinforced stitching, and water-resistant fabric mean your backpack will last for many trips.
- Carry-On Compliance: Always check the airline’s specific size and weight limits for carry-on bags. Most backpacks designed for travel will clearly state their dimensions.
Important Materials
The material of your backpack affects its durability, weight, and water resistance.
- Nylon: This is a very popular choice. It’s strong, lightweight, and can be treated to be water-resistant. Ripstop nylon is even tougher and resists tears.
- Polyester: Another good option, polyester is durable and often more affordable than nylon. It’s also resistant to stretching and shrinking.
- Canvas: While stylish, canvas can be heavier and less water-resistant than synthetic materials. It might be better for shorter trips or when you don’t expect to encounter rain.
- Water-Resistant Coatings: Many backpacks have coatings like PU (polyurethane) or PVC (polyvinyl chloride) to keep your belongings dry in light rain.
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ality
Several things can tell you if a backpack is well-made.
- What Makes It Better:
- Sturdy Zippers: YKK zippers are known for their strength and smooth operation.
- Reinforced Stitching: Double stitching in high-stress areas prevents seams from breaking.
- Good Padding: Thick, comfortable padding on straps and the back panel is a sign of quality.
- Internal Frame (sometimes): Some travel backpacks have a lightweight internal frame that helps support the load and improve comfort.
- What Might Reduce Quality:
- Flimsy Zippers: Cheap zippers can break easily, making the backpack hard to use.
- Thin Fabric: Fabric that feels thin or easily tears is a sign of lower quality.
- Lack of Padding: If the straps or back are not padded, it will be uncomfortable to carry.
- Poorly Placed Pockets: If pockets are hard to reach or don’t hold items securely, they aren’t very useful.
